2019 is a critical year for Wisconsin and Minnesota as our states work together to grow renewable energy and reduce pollution from fossil fuels.

Dairyland Power in Wisconsin and Minnesota Power in Minnesota, are asking regulators for permission to build a new fracked gas power plant in northern Wisconsin. Fracked gas is a danger to our health and environment across its entire life cycle, and is a major source of greenhouse gas emissions. The science is very clear that in order to mitigate the worst effects of climate change, we need to be moving towards 100% clean energy, not investing in more fossil fuels.
